NT
Jewies
&
Queenies
with
Justin
Jones
&
Nigel
Webster
Jewies
or
mulloway
(both
the
southern
and
northern
varieties)
are
a
dream
fish,
keenly
sought
after
by
many
frustrated
anglers.
A
trip
to
the
Northern
Territory
and
some
local
guidance
soon
put
Nigel
onto
some
solid
black
jewies,
proving
you
don't
always
have
to
do
the
hard
yards
to
hook
up
on
one
of
these
highly-prized
fish.
Throw
in
some
great
popper
action
with
chrome-plated
queenies
and
you
come
up
with
a
day's
fishing
that
won't
be
easily
forgotten!

Mulwala
Murray
Cod
with
Peta
Walter
&
Roger
Miles
Lake
Mulwala,
on
the
mighty
Murray
River,
is
the
home
to
a
healthy
population
of
Australia's
largest
native
freshwater
fish;
the
legendary
Murray
Cod.
Finding
cod
in
this
expansive
body
of
water
can
be
a
daunting
challenge...
and
landing
a
big
one
amongst
all
that
drowned
timber
is
even
tougher!

Top
Water
Bream
with
Shannon
Watson
&
Michael
Geary
Bream
are
a
favourite
species,
targeted
by
anglers
right
around
the
nation,
and
they
can
be
found
in
almost
all
of
our
estuaries.
In
this
information-packed
story,
Michael
Geary,
a
prize-winning
ABT
Tournament
angler,
shares
his
tips
and
techniques
on
catching
these
feisty
little
fish.
As
you'll
discover,
sighting
bream
and
then
casting
hard-bodied
lures
at
them
can
produce
some
great
top-water
action!

Baitfish
&
Predators
with
Peter
Morse
&
Ed
Vander
Kruk
“Where
you
find
the
food,
you’ll
find
the
predators”
is
a
rule
of
fishing
that
should
never
be
ignored.
Peter
Morse
and
friends
travel
to
the
inside
flats
of
Fraser
Island,
where
they
find
both
the
bait
and
the
hunters.
Witness
exciting,
visual
flats
action
on
big
queenfish
through
the
high
tide,
then
head
offshore
on
a
falling
tide
to
mix
it
with
schools
of
tuna
and
scad
feeding
on
whitebait...
and
a
BIG
surprise
in
the
form
of
a
cracking
cobia!

Cania
Dam
with
Starlo
&
The
Paynes
Steve
'Starlo'
Starling
joins
Leeann
and
Robert
Payne
to
explore
beautiful
Cania
Gorge
Dam,
in
south
eastern
Queensland.
The
trio
discover
some
healthy
schools
of
suspended
bass
and
suss'
out
how
best
to
target
them
on
plastics
and
hard-bodies,
while
also
sampling
the
delight's
of
Cania's
resident
saratoga.
This
one
is
jam-packed
with
tips!

Salmon
on
the
Rocks
with
Starlo
Starlo's
at
it
again,
this
time
chucking
Spanyid
metal
lures
from
the
stones
in
southern
NSW,
hunting
those
hard-fighting
Australian
salmon.
As
well
as
providing
some
valuable
fishing
tips,
watching
this
segment
just
might
save
your
life!
